FusionProtFeatures for RAB22A_VAPB


check buttonMain function of each fusion partner protein. (from UniProt)
HgeneTgene
RAB22A

Q9UL26

VAPB

O95292

Plays a role in endocytosis and intracellular proteintransport. Mediates trafficking of TF from early endosomes torecycling endosomes (PubMed:16537905). Required for NGF-mediatedendocytosis of NTRK1, and subsequent neurite outgrowth(PubMed:21849477). Binds GTP and GDP and has low GTPase activity.Alternates between a GTP-bound active form and a GDP-boundinactive form (PubMed:16537905). {ECO:0000269|PubMed:16537905,ECO:0000269|PubMed:21849477}. Participates in the endoplasmic reticulum unfoldedprotein response (UPR) by inducing ERN1/IRE1 activity. Involved incellular calcium homeostasis regulation.{ECO:0000269|PubMed:16891305, ECO:0000269|PubMed:20940299,ECO:0000269|PubMed:22131369}.
